Scott Anderson
War correspondent Scott Anderson is a graduate of the
University of Iowa Writers' Workshop. Anderson, whose books
include "The Man Who Tried to Save the World," "Triage" and
"The 4 O'Clock Murders" has written from Beirut, Northern
Ireland, Chechnya, Israel, Sudan, Sarajevo, El Salvador, and
a number of other war-torn areas. He is a contributing
writer at the New York Times Magazine and work has
also appeared in Vanity Fair, Esquire, Harper's,
Outside and many other publications.
